Soviet social poster “No!” has an anti-alcohol trend. The poster was painted by the artist V.I. Govorkov in 1954, with a purpose of propaganda against drunkenness and alcoholism. The poster shows a well-dressed man who is being offered to have a shot, while having a dinner, but with a gesture of his hand he refuses the glass with vodka. The name of the poster speaks for itself – “No!” to alcohol. The poster is made in the style of social realism.
